How They Were Innovating

They have an in-house research and development team to conduct R&D prior to the production of their plants. Microplant focused on trees and has since expanded into various other plants and vegetation including shrubs, blueberries, hazelnuts, raspberries, hops, grapes, perennials, timber products and bulb crops. They have produced more than 50 Genera and 500 cultivars with at least 3 times as many others attempted and/or are currently working on in order to successfully develop the plants they do offer. Impact of the R&D Tax Credit

Microplant Nurseries has been successfully growing plants wholesale and by contract micropropagation since its opening. They continue to test and develop new Stage 2 unrooted microcuttings and Stage 3 in vitro rooted plants for the 500 cultivars they have produced. Microplant Nurseries built and moved into a new building in 2000, which allowed them to computerize their entire process and connect their various departments. With the funds received from the R&D Tax Credit, Jasinski says the credit will help Microplant Nurseries will “help in covering some recurring capital project expenses” to allow their innovation to continue.
